The Athletic’s Sam Blum joins Foul Territory to explain the key-man clause in Shohei Ohtani’s contract that could allow him to opt out if Mark Walter or Andrew Friedman are no longer with the Dodgers. Blum discusses why Walter’s recent Lakers sale and the uncertainty surrounding his ownership have brought the clause back into focus, while detailing why Ohtani remains happy in Los Angeles and is still expected to fulfill his 10-year deal. Plus, Sam dives into whether key-man clauses could become more common for MLB superstars and shares his early impressions of John Mozeliak’s impact on the Angels.
